To Whom It May Concern:

Pursuant to the Illinois Freedom of Information Act (5 ILCS 140/1 to 11), I hereby request the following records:

A list of all agencies besides the Chicago Police Department that have access to the Citizen and Law Enforcement Analysis and Reporting (CLEAR) system and its underlying data.

I am confident that this list of agency names can be delivered due to the fact that agencies have to sign up to gain access to this data by filling out both the agency name in the "Security Requirements for Accessing Information from CLEAR - Citizens and Law Enforcement Analysis and Reporting" section and "AGENCY ACCESS FORM: Identification of Agency CLEAR Administrators" section within the "CLEAR Registration Packet" (https://home.chicagopolice.org/wp-content/uploads/2016/05/CLEAR-Registration-Packet.pdf)

In this same registration packet it is highlighted that the Chicago Police Department is reaching out to other law enforcement agencies in order to get them to sign up to access CLEAR data. This is clearly stated in the section of this document titled "Introduction to Criminal Justice Integration Project and CLEAR":

"There is presently a convergence of technological understanding and a driving criminal justice rationale for this cooperative program. The Chicago Police Department is encouraging all law enforcement and criminal justice agencies to join CLEAR as equal partners as it strives to share what can only be described as an integrated criminal justice information system."

The Chicago Police Department received your Freedom of Information Act Request on January 29, 2018. Under the Freedom of Information Act, a public body may extend the time to respond to a FOIA request by up to 5 business days for a limited number of reasons. Pursuant to Section 5 ILCS 140/3(e) of the Act, the CPD is extending the time to respond to your request by 5 business days from the original due date for the following reason(s):

( ) The requested records are stored in whole or in part at other locations other than the office having charge of the requested records;

( ) The requested records require the collection of a substantial number of specified records;

( ) The request is couched in categorical terms and requires an extensive search for the records responsive to it;

( ) The requested records have not been located in the course of routine search and additional efforts are being made to locate them;

( ) The requested records require examination and evaluation by personnel having the necessary competence and discretion to determine if they are exempt from disclosure or should be revealed only with appropriate deletions;

( ) The request for records cannot be complied by the public body within the time limits prescribed by the Freedom of Information Act, 5 ILCS 140/3(c), without unduly burdening or interfering with the operations of the public body;

(X) There is a need for consultation, which shall be conducted with all practicable speed, with another public body or among two or more components of any public body having a substantial interest in the determination or in the subject matter of the request.
